What to Look For in a Campground or RV Park
Not all campgrounds have flush restrooms. Primitive sites may have vault toilets or nothing at all. If reliable facilities matter, check before you drive in.
Hot showers aren't guaranteed — some campgrounds have cold-water only or coin-operated showers. Dispersed sites rarely have any.
If you're traveling in an RV or camper, a dump station is essential. Many primitive campgrounds don't have them — plan your route around parks that do.
Potable water isn't available at all campgrounds, especially in more remote areas of Arkansas. Bring your own supply or a reliable filter.
Electric hookups let you plug in without running a generator. Most RV parks offer them, but national forest and BLM campgrounds usually don't.
